1.) Ability to not only fully design the Login Page, but also to Add Custom Code to the Page.
2.) Create a 'Login Element' that could be added to the Login Page, OR that same Login Element could be added to Any Page in CF. EX: The Login Element could be added to a Thank You Page after a Purchase and the Buyer could go straight into the Customer Center. OR it could be added to a Site Home Page for easy access directly from the Root Domain.
3.) Set the Default on the Login Element to Create a Password (just like 1.0). Give the ability to Toggle from 'Create Password' to 'Login'.
4.) For Courses, give us the ability to set a Course as 'Free', which anyone could access whether they are Enrolled or Not.
5.) Add the ability to 'Deep Link' into any Level of the Course - Course Home, Module, SubModule or Lesson. EX: I email my student a Link to a particular Lesson (https://www.mydomain.com/courses/courseName/moduleName/this-is-the-lesson)
When they land on the Login Page it remembers the URL and after Logging In the student is taken directly to the Lesson. If by chance they are Not Enrolled (or the Course is Not 'Free') a Warning Message will be triggered and the student would be sent to the Customer Center.